![]() ![]() This article addresses two of the most common methods - manual migration and using a migration plugin. There are a few different ways to move a WordPress site from your localhost to a live server. Migrate your WordPress site from localhost to a live server If you’re new to local development, then Local might be your best choice, as it strikes the right balance between ease of use and customization while having some great WordPress-specific features. Laragon is an extremely lightweight, general purpose local PHP development stack. One of its unique features includes the ability to migrate your local site to a live server (if you use the premium version of the software). ServerPress is designed for local WordPress website development. Local development tools for Mac and Windows XAMPP is a long-standing, general-purpose, local PHP development stack. Lando is less beginner-friendly, but is a highly-customizable local development environment which allows you to closely match your live server configuration. It’s definitely worth using if you host with Kinsta. DevKinsta is similar to Local, but is a slightly less mature product. It also has the option to send a ‘live link’ to clients so they can access your local site for a brief period of time. It has some great features to assist with development like support for WordPress command-line interface (WP-CLI) and multiple versions of PHP, MySQL, and Apache/NGINX. This local development tool is specifically designed for WordPress. Local development tools for Linux, Mac, and Windows The easiest method is to use an application that includes all of the components needed to run WordPress (server, database, and PHP support). ![]() ![]() There are a few different approaches to developing locally. WordPress development tools for localhost Important: Even when working locally, you should take backups and use version control to avoid losing your work. Most local development environments are free to use, which can save hundreds or thousands of dollars over the course of development. If you build your site on a live server, you (or your client) will be paying for hosting costs that entire time. Depending on the type of website you’re building, development could take weeks or months. Anything you do on your local server won’t affect your live server. Taking a flight? Working from a location with slow or unreliable internet? Local development is perfect in this context. You don’t need to be connected to the internet.Because you aren’t using an internet connection to develop, you’ll be safe from hacking attempts due to any vulnerabilities in plugins or themes you may be using. You can easily experiment or carry out updates locally to check for any errors or incompatibilities. Instead, you can work directly with the files you need. Developing locally is fast as there’s no need to push files to the live server. Here are the advantages of developing on localhost: If migrating a WordPress website from a localhost is time consuming and prone to error, why shouldn’t you just develop on a live server from the start? Five reasons to develop your WordPress site on a localhost So, in some cases, a manual migration is still the best option. While a plugin is the easiest solution for migration, you may run into some issues if your site is particularly large or if there are any conflicts between the local and live environments. The process can be quite involved and take some time if you do it manually. If you’re relatively new to website development, moving a WordPress website from localhost to a live website will require a bit of extra learning. Developing websites locally has a lot of advantages over a live server, but once site development is complete, it needs to be moved to a live website and made publicly accessible. ![]() It’s common practice for WordPress developers to create websites on a localhost, which is a local server hosted on their personal computer or laptop. ![]()
0 Comments
Leave a Reply. |